What is Wind Shear Anyway?

At its core, wind shear is all about abrupt changes in wind speed or direction. Imagine you're cruising along in an airplane, and suddenly the wind decides to throw a curveball—changing direction or picking up speed in a flash. These changes can occur either vertically, like when you’re ascending or descending, or horizontally, swooping across the ground beneath you.

Sounds simple, right? But here's the kicker: predicting these sudden gusts is where things get complicated. The unpredictability of wind shear can turn a smooth flight into a nail-biter, especially during those all-important phases of takeoff and landing. What Can You Do as a Pilot?

If you’re in the cockpit, your best defense against wind shear starts well before you even take off. Familiarize yourself with the local weather patterns, especially in areas prone to wind shear, like valleys or mountain ranges. Knowing when to expect turbulence can make a huge difference. Additionally, when you’re approaching landing, keeping a sharp eye on changes in airspeed and altitude can catch those sudden shifts before they catch you off-guard.

And don't forget to rely on your instruments. Your flight displays are like your trusty sidekicks during the journey; they can often alert you to sudden wind shifts. Never underestimate the power of good communication either—staying connected with air traffic control provides you with real-time updates and insights on the conditions ahead.
